While football and basketball often take the spotlight for collegiate sports, the ASU men's swim team has garnered national attention this season.
The Arizona State men’s swim program has worked and thrived in silence over the last few years.
“I didn't know I would be at this level right now when I came to ASU,” Marchand said. “We were maybe top-10 when I came here and the team was already climbing a lot of steps. Last year, I think we took maybe nine swimmers to NCAAs and I feel like this year we’re going to bring like twice as more.” This season hasn’t been anything short of stunning. Against the reigning national champion California in Tempe, Marchand blazed through his 400 IM race and set the NCAA record at 3:31.84.
Marchand’s run at the top is backed by his teammates hitting higher marks this season. Graduate student Grant House leads the nation in the 200 free and is second in the 100 IM. Redshirt junior Alex Colson ranks second in the 200 fly, while redshirt junior Jack Dolan is within the top five in the 100 back and 50 free events.
Bowman’s expectations of winning a national championship became more pronounced once distance swimmer Zalan Sarkany joined ASU in January. Sarkany, a true freshman from Hungary, broke Scott Brackett's 1000 free record set in 1984 in his first race. He set an even better mark in the same race the next day and is fifth in the nation.
